Abstract

A truck is a major form of transporting goods on land because of its efficiency in terms of cost and effectiveness. Increased truck usage has heightened the risk of component failure, particularly in the rear-wheel-drive axle, which is prone to structural problems. Therefore, this study aimed to analyze the causes of rear-wheeldrive axle failure in trucks through numerical simulations based on the finite element method, using Finite Element Modeling and Postprocessing (FEMAP) software. The axle material used was AISI 4140, with four test models, including a version without defects and three other models with variations in defects at certain locations. During the investigation, the analysis was conducted to observe the effect of stress on axle performance under various defect conditions. The simulation results showed the maximum von Misses stress on the shaft without defects reached 115.19 MPa, which was significantly lower than the yield strength limit of 415 MPa of the material. The maximum shear stress of 124.67 MPa also remained lesser compared to the material allowable limit of 239.45 MPa, showing that the shaft was safe in a condition without defects. However, in the shaft model with defects, stress intensity factor (KI) values were recorded at 17.80, 15.01, and 20.325 MPa.m1/2, which exceeded the material fracture toughness (KIC) value of 10 MPa.m1/2. The results signified that KI KIC condition, facilitating accelerated crack propagation on the shaft, showing the potential for structural failure. This study provided a deep understanding of the importance of defect mitigation to maintain the reliability and safety of truck operations

Abstract

The purpose of this community service activity is to provide education on waste management to the students of the Quranic Recitation Hall Babussalam, Limpok Village. This community service activity was attended by 20 students, consisting of groups of primary and junior high schools, divided into two stages, namely: making the rubbish bin and counseling on waste management at the Quranic Recitation Hall Babussalam. The counseling and socialization were carried out by direct introduction to students and by providing waste collection facilities according to the types of waste. The results of this community service activity can be declared successful as seen from their seriousness in listening to the presentation of the material, responding spontaneously, and discussing seriously during the activity. They can understand the benefits of solid waste management and are proven to be able to mention the negative and positive effects of waste. Garbage can be an income if it is sorted out and a disaster if it is disposed of in any place according to them and an agent of change, especially in the environment where they live and the Limpok Village community in general. In conclusion, all participants had a good understanding of the introduction to waste processing methods, types of organic and inorganic waste, and residues which were marked by the ability of each participant to answer questions given by the service team.
